Qualcomm talked about second quarter earnings On Wednesday that was consistent with analyst expectations however noticed gross sales of telephone chips, a core enterprise for the corporate, fall 17% 12 months over 12 months.

Qualcomm shares fell greater than 2% in prolonged buying and selling.

Right here’s how the chipmaker carried out towards Refinitiv’s consensus rankings:

  • EPS: $2.15 a share, adjusted, versus an expectation of $2.15 a share
  • he gained: $9.27 billion, in comparison with expectations of $9.1 billion

Within the quarter ending in March, Qualcomm stated web earnings fell 42% to $1.70 billion, or $1.52 per share, from $2.93 billion, or $2.57 per share, a 12 months earlier.

Qualcomm stated it expects gross sales of $8.5 billion within the present quarter, which fell in need of Wall Road’s forecast of $9.14 billion. Analysts had anticipated earnings steering for the present quarter at $2.16 per share, however Qualcomm stated it expects it to be round $1.80.

Qualcomm CEO Cristiano Amon, in an announcement, blamed the outcomes on a difficult setting, and the corporate stated it had seen no proof of a restoration in smartphone gross sales in China. The smartphone market is wanting ahead to a troublesome 2023, as shipments to the worldwide market fell by greater than 14% within the first quarter, Based on IDC.

“The evolving macroeconomic backdrop has led to an additional deterioration in demand, significantly in cellphones, of a better magnitude than we beforehand anticipated,” Qualcomm CEO Cristiano Amon stated on a name with analysts.

Qualcomm’s chip section, referred to as QCT, sells smartphone processors, automotive chips and different elements to superior electronics. Its income fell 17% to $7.94 billion through the quarter.

The majority of QCT’s gross sales come from telephone chips, that are the processors on the coronary heart of most Android telephones. Qualcomm reported $6.11 billion in telephone gross sales, down 17% from a 12 months in the past.

Qualcomm stated it expects a bigger than normal decline within the third quarter for QTL income, saying that was associated to the “timing of the acquisition by the modem-only telephone buyer.” Qualcomm hardly ever discusses its enterprise with Apple, and didn’t identify the corporate, however Apple buys modems from the corporate for iPhones and different gadgets.

Qualcomm’s automotive enterprise, which incorporates chips and software program for vehicles, stays small, though it confirmed 20% development for the quarter to $447 million in income. Reported as a part of a QTL.

Qualcomm’s licensing section, QTL, which sells entry to applied sciences wanted for mobile service, reported an 18% annual decline in income to $1.29 billion.

Qualcomm stated it generated $900 million in share buybacks and paid $800 million in dividends through the quarter.
